Stepping into Waun-Gron Park station, potential travelers will find essential services to cater to their ticketing needs. While there isn't a ticket office open on site, fret not, as ticket machines stand ready to process card payments and dispense tickets. They also allow the retrieval of tickets purchased online. Accessibility is a considered aspect at Waun-Gron Park, with induction loops and accessible ticket machines enabling a smoother experience for those with hearing impairments.
In terms of ease of movement, the station accepts that there are some challenges. Step-free access is partway enabled, with both Platform 1 (to Radyr) and Platform 2 (to Cardiff) accessible via ramps. However, these ramps have a steep gradient, which should be noted for users with limited mobility. For additional assistance, help points are available, but staff presence is limited. Unfortunately, the absence of a waiting room and toilets might require passengers to plan accordingly for comfort before their journey.

Lea Green train station is equipped to make your travel experience as smooth as possible. With a ticket office open from dawn until midnight on weekdays and extended hours on weekends, purchasing or collecting your tickets is hassle-free. The station boasts accessible ticket machines and induction loops for the hearing impaired. If you're using a smartcard for your journey, rest assured that both issuance and validation can be handled at the station.
Despite the lack of refreshment facilities or waiting rooms, the station does offer seating areas for a comfortable wait. It is important to note the absence of toilets and baby changing facilities. Additionally, steps provide access to the platforms, though lengthy ramps are available for those in need of step-free pathways. However, there are no accessible taxis available, so make sure to plan ahead if additional transport assistance is needed.
